Dokumentacja platformy MLKitBarcodeScanning

BarcodeDriverLicense

class BarcodeDriverLicense : NSObject

Prawo jazdy lub dowód osobisty.

Prawo jazdy ANSI zawiera więcej pól niż ta klasa. Aby uzyskać dostęp do innych pól, możesz użyć właściwości rawValue obiektu Barcode.

  • Imię właściciela.

    Deklaracja

    Swift

    var firstName: String? { get }
  • Drugie imię posiadacza

    Deklaracja

    Swift

    var middleName: String? { get }
  • Nazwisko posiadacza karty.

    Deklaracja

    Swift

    var lastName: String? { get }
  • Płeć posiadacza. 1 to mężczyzna, a 2 to kobieta.

    Deklaracja

    Swift

    var gender: String? { get }
  • Miasto, w którym znajduje się adres właściciela.

    Deklaracja

    Swift

    var addressCity: String? { get }
  • Stan adresu właściciela.

    Deklaracja

    Swift

    var addressState: String? { get }
  • Ulica, na której znajduje się adres właściciela.

    Deklaracja

    Swift

    var addressStreet: String? { get }
  • Kod pocztowy adresu właściciela.

    Deklaracja

    Swift

    var addressZip: String? { get }
  • Urodziny posiadacza karty. Format daty zależy od kraju, który ją wydał.

    Deklaracja

    Swift

    var birthDate: String? { get }
  • DL prawa jazdy, ID dla dowodów tożsamości.

    Deklaracja

    Swift

    var documentType: String? { get }
  • Numer identyfikacyjny prawa jazdy.

    Deklaracja

    Swift

    var licenseNumber: String? { get }
  • Data ważności prawa jazdy. Format daty zależy od kraju, który ją wydał.

    Deklaracja

    Swift

    var expiryDate: String? { get }
  • Format daty zależy od kraju, który ją wydał.

    Deklaracja

    Swift

    var issuingDate: String? { get }
  • Kraj, w którym został wydany DL/ID.

    Deklaracja

    Swift

    var issuingCountry: String? { get }
  • Niedostępne.